00:33Canadian Nicole Andrews-Sission is on vacation at the resort next door,
00:37capturing several videos of the dramatic incident.
00:40A helicopter did come and started scooping water out of the ocean
00:45and was dropping it onto the fire.
00:48And it took a long time, it felt like, to get it sort of contained.
00:53NBC News reached out to Viva Dominicus Beach by Wyndham
00:56and was connected to a reservation department representative
00:59who confirmed a fire on the property broke out around 11 a.m. today.
01:03This video appearing to show the charred-out aftermath near the resort's front entrance.
